Commit c193803
committed
Raise wasi-sdk to 25 and wabt to 1.0.37 (bytecodealliance#4187)
Raise wasi-sdk to 25 and wabt to 1.0.37. It includes
- Refactor CI workflow to install WASI-SDK and WABT from a composite action
- Use ExternalProject to bring wasm-apps for few samples. file/ wasi-threads/
- Refactor sample build and test steps in SGX compilation workflow for improved clarity and efficiency (workaround)
Add CMake support for EMSCRIPTEN and WAMRC, update module paths1 parent 6f6654f commit c193803
File tree
17 files changed
+213
-266
lines changed- .github
- actions/install-wasi-sdk-wabt
- workflows
- product-mini/platforms/linux-sgx
- samples
- cmake
- debug-tools
- wasm-apps
- file
- wasm-app
- linux-perf
- cmake
- wasi-threads
- wasm-apps
17 files changed
+213
-266
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| 5 | + | |
| 6 | + | |
| 7 | + |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
| 11 | + | |
| 12 | + | |
| 13 | + | |
| 14 | + | |
| 15 | + | |
| 16 | + | |
| 17 | + | |
| 18 | + | |
| 19 | + | |
| 20 | + | |
| 21 | + | |
| 22 | + | |
| 23 | + | |
| 24 | + | |
| 25 | + | |
| 26 | + | |
| 27 | + | |
| 28 | + | |
| 29 | + | |
| 30 | + | |
| 31 | + | |
| 32 | + |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
| 36 | + | |
| 37 | + | |
| 38 | + | |
| 39 | + |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
| 44 | + | |
| 45 | + | |
| 46 | + | |
| 47 | + | |
| 48 | + | |
| 49 | + | |
| 50 | + | |
| 51 | + | |
| 52 | + | |
| 53 | + | |
| 54 | + | |
| 55 | + | |
| 56 | + | |
| 57 | + | |
| 58 | + | |
| 59 | + | |
| 60 | + | |
| 61 | + | |
| 62 | + | |
| 63 | + | |
| 64 | + | |
| 65 | + | |
| 66 | + | |
| 67 | + | |
| 68 | + | |
| 69 | + | |
| 70 | + | |
| 71 | + | |
| 72 | + | |
| 73 | + | |
| 74 | + | |
| 75 | + | |
| 76 | + | |
| 77 | + | |
| 78 | + | |
| 79 | + | |
| 80 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
315 | 315 | | |
316 | 316 | | |
317 | 317 | | |
318 | | - | |
319 | | - | |
320 | | - | |
321 | | - | |
322 | | - | |
323 | | - | |
324 | | - | |
325 | | - | |
326 | 318 | | |
327 | 319 | | |
328 | 320 | | |
| 321 | + | |
329 | 322 | | |
330 | 323 | | |
331 | 324 | | |
| |||
346 | 339 | | |
347 | 340 | | |
348 | 341 | | |
349 | | - | |
350 | | - | |
351 | | - | |
352 | | - | |
353 | | - | |
354 | | - | |
355 | | - | |
356 | | - | |
357 | | - | |
358 | | - | |
359 | | - | |
360 | | - | |
361 | | - | |
| 342 | + | |
| 343 | + | |
| 344 | + | |
| 345 | + | |
362 | 346 | | |
363 | 347 | | |
364 | 348 | | |
| |||
397 | 381 | | |
398 | 382 | | |
399 | 383 | | |
400 | | - | |
401 | | - | |
402 | | - | |
403 | | - | |
404 | | - | |
405 | | - | |
406 | | - | |
407 | | - | |
408 | 384 | | |
409 | 385 | | |
410 | 386 | | |
| |||
430 | 406 | | |
431 | 407 | | |
432 | 408 | | |
433 | | - | |
434 | | - | |
435 | | - | |
436 | | - | |
437 | | - | |
438 | | - | |
| 409 | + | |
| 410 | + | |
| 411 | + | |
| 412 | + | |
439 | 413 | | |
440 | 414 | | |
441 | 415 | | |
| |||
464 | 438 | | |
465 | 439 | | |
466 | 440 | | |
467 | | - | |
468 | | - | |
469 | | - | |
470 | | - | |
471 | | - | |
472 | | - | |
473 | | - | |
474 | | - | |
475 | 441 | | |
476 | 442 | | |
477 | 443 | | |
| 444 | + | |
478 | 445 | | |
479 | 446 | | |
480 | 447 | | |
481 | 448 | | |
482 | | - | |
483 | | - | |
484 | | - | |
485 | | - | |
486 | | - | |
487 | | - | |
488 | | - | |
489 | | - | |
490 | | - | |
491 | | - | |
492 | | - | |
493 | | - | |
494 | | - | |
495 | 449 | | |
496 | 450 | | |
497 | 451 | | |
| |||
503 | 457 | | |
504 | 458 | | |
505 | 459 | | |
| 460 | + | |
| 461 | + | |
| 462 | + | |
| 463 | + | |
| 464 | + | |
| 465 | + | |
506 | 466 | | |
507 | 467 | | |
508 | 468 | | |
509 | 469 | | |
510 | 470 | | |
511 | 471 | | |
| 472 | + | |
512 | 473 | | |
513 | 474 | | |
514 | 475 | | |
| |||
634 | 595 | | |
635 | 596 | | |
636 | 597 | | |
637 | | - | |
638 | | - | |
639 | | - | |
640 | | - | |
641 | 598 | | |
642 | 599 | | |
643 | 600 | | |
| |||
706 | 663 | | |
707 | 664 | | |
708 | 665 | | |
709 | | - | |
710 | | - | |
711 | | - | |
712 | | - | |
713 | | - | |
| 666 | + | |
| 667 | + | |
| 668 | + | |
714 | 669 | | |
715 | 670 | | |
716 | 671 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
228 | 228 | | |
229 | 229 | | |
230 | 230 | | |
231 | | - | |
232 | | - | |
233 | | - | |
234 | | - | |
235 | | - | |
236 | | - | |
237 | | - | |
238 | | - | |
239 | 231 | | |
240 | 232 | | |
241 | 233 | | |
242 | 234 | | |
243 | | - | |
244 | | - | |
245 | | - | |
246 | | - | |
247 | | - | |
248 | | - | |
| 235 | + | |
| 236 | + | |
| 237 | + | |
| 238 | + | |
249 | 239 | | |
250 | 240 | | |
251 | 241 | | |
| |||
260 | 250 | | |
261 | 251 | | |
262 | 252 | | |
263 | | - | |
264 | | - | |
265 | | - | |
266 | | - | |
267 | | - | |
268 | | - | |
269 | | - | |
270 | | - | |
271 | 253 | | |
272 | 254 | | |
273 | 255 | | |
| |||
277 | 259 | | |
278 | 260 | | |
279 | 261 | | |
280 | | - | |
281 | | - | |
282 | | - | |
283 | | - | |
284 | | - | |
285 | | - | |
286 | | - | |
287 | | - | |
288 | | - | |
289 | | - | |
290 | | - | |
291 | | - | |
292 | | - | |
| 262 | + | |
| 263 | + | |
| 264 | + | |
| 265 | + | |
293 | 266 | | |
294 | 267 | | |
295 | 268 | | |
| |||
356 | 329 | | |
357 | 330 | | |
358 | 331 | | |
| 332 | + | |
359 | 333 | | |
360 | 334 | | |
361 | 335 | | |
362 | 336 | | |
363 | 337 | | |
364 | | - | |
| 338 | + | |
365 | 339 | | |
366 | 340 | | |
367 | 341 | | |
| |||
0 commit comments